How they compare
Uzbekistan currently reports -0.5488 terawatt-hours against -0.9012 terawatt-hours in South Africa, a difference of 0.3524 terawatt-hours.
The two have swapped places 17 times across 40 shared years of data; in 1986 it was South Africa ahead.
South Africa ranks 52nd and Uzbekistan ranks 51st of 77 countries.
Across the 5 decades both report, South Africa averaged higher in 2 and Uzbekistan in 3.
Head to head by decade
| Decade | South Africa | Uzbekistan | Difference | Ahead |
|---|---|---|---|---|
| 1980s | -0.001 terawatt-hours | 4.04 terawatt-hours | 4.04 terawatt-hours | Uzbekistan |
| 1990s | 0.9852 terawatt-hours | 14.87 terawatt-hours | 13.89 terawatt-hours | Uzbekistan |
| 2000s | 2.14 terawatt-hours | -3.55 terawatt-hours | 5.69 terawatt-hours | South Africa |
| 2010s | 0.9372 terawatt-hours | 2.97 terawatt-hours | 2.04 terawatt-hours | Uzbekistan |
| 2020s | 0.6996 terawatt-hours | -4.28 terawatt-hours | 4.98 terawatt-hours | South Africa |
Averages of every year both report within each decade.
